Managing Irrigation Canals and Custom Landscaping
Eagle’s irrigation system offers green lawns and thriving gardens, but it also requires homeowners to be thoughtful about drainage. Many homes are located near ditches or small canals that fill in the spring and early summer. Well-maintained sump pumps and professionally designed drainage systems help mitigate that extra water.
Custom landscaping is a hallmark of Eagle homes. It adds curb appeal and enhances lifestyle, but it’s important to make sure those stunning features don’t unintentionally funnel water toward your foundation. With careful planning and consultation, even the most complex landscapes can function beautifully and safely.
Staying Ahead of Eagle Idaho Crawlspace Moisture
Crawlspaces play an important role in a home’s structure and indoor air quality. Keeping them dry doesn’t require luck—just consistent care. Crawlspaces in newer homes are sometimes overlooked during regular maintenance, but they can stay dry with basic upkeep like directing water away from the foundation and maintaining downspouts.
If moisture does sneak in, catching it early makes all the difference. A quick inspection, especially after heavy rain or irrigation, helps catch small issues before they become larger concerns. With early action, cleanup is fast and simple.

Preventive Tips for Peace of Mind in Eagle Idaho and Beyond
Being proactive is the best way to protect your home. Here are some simple strategies Eagle residents can use:
- Inspect Irrigation Systems: Adjust sprinkler heads so they don’t saturate your foundation.
- Regrade Landscaping if Necessary: Soil should slope gently away from the house.
- Keep Gutters Clean and Functional: Prevent overflow and direct water away effectively.
- Install or Test a Sump Pump: Add a backup battery system to prevent outages from compromising drainage.
- Get a Crawlspace Checkup: An annual inspection keeps you ahead of potential issues.
- Use Gravel or Permeable Borders Around the Foundation: Encourage water to drain safely.
- Work with Drainage Experts Before Big Landscaping Projects: Planning ahead ensures form meets function.
